Why should I choose Sociology as an optional subject?

Written (1750) + Personality Test (275):

  • Out of 1750, the Optional weighs 500 marks.
  • Out of the remaining 1250, 75 Marks in GS 1 (Society) + 50 Marks in GS 2 (Social Justice)
  • Apart from that, some direct and indirect help in GS 3, GS 4, Essay and Personality Tests.
  • To conclude, Sociology helps explicitly and implicitly helps in Essay + GS Paper 1 + GS Paper 2 + GS Paper 3 + Ethics (Helps)+ Optional (500), including Personality Tests.
  • Overlap with GS papers: Especially GS 1 (society), GS 2 (social justice), and Essay.
  • Helps in interview/personality test due to better understanding of social issues.
